Sooooo...

Not much has happened in regards to the original plan - surge tank etc (that's still sitting in the shed)

Just returned from 6 weeks in the states so the car was supposed to be put on the back burner...

But;

Volk Racing CE28N's (Jack's old wheels) have been fitted (I will get some better pictures this weekend)

18 x 9 +42

With 245, 40, 18 RE003's

Surprisingly not as wide as I had anticipated, this is due to the guard rolling in the past to try accommodate the XXR's

I will be pulling 1 degree of camber out when it goes in for the alignment next break and possibly dropping the arse another 10mm. This will give me flush fitment and with the 245 rubber a rather tough appearance I hope.







Before I left, a genuine V8 STI Wing came up for sale in Albany.

A deal was made and it was driven up by a mate for a carton of beer

Into paint and it was cleaned up, few dents and chips filled and painted to match;








The 03 STI rear end conversion - bumper and tail-lights will also be happening when I can find a set of them.



Interior wise, added the GFB Short Shifter, that has made the gearbox feel a bit tighter although it needs new bushings (waiting to be installed)

Bought a set of Amber Defi's off Jayden on Antilag to match my new cluster and HVAC color.

Had to hard-wire all of the gauges to the control box as the plugs were cactus.

Fuel Pressure, Oil Pressure and Boost. They currently sit in the ATI triple pod which I will get a pic of today as well. Sorry about the shit pic below;




Otherwise, I have an X-Force cannon which will be fitted when I earn some money to do so :P

It will have the tip extended and I may paint it black for a stealth look..




After the exhaust goes on, the car will be going into ASG for a retune to suit.

That's about all for now until I get some decent pics of the interior and wheels as neither has been done justice.

Stoked with the wheels and they weigh 2/3 bugger all


Stay Tuned!
